But life of a sportsperson is not always easy in India.  There have been enough people who have given off their best for the country and yet live in penury.  Our hockey team is one example.  There have been enough stories of athletes selling their Olympic medals to make ends meet or do hard labor on street despite being part of Gold medalist teams at the Olympics.

These days, however, some folks do get attention, but looks matter.  Vijender Singh, the boxer, has got over his lack of English language articulation in the elitist media-minds to become a Page 3 regular and a model.
